I'm not the biggest Dropkick Murphy's fan, but I tend to enjoy what they do. This is the DKM CD that I enjoy listening to the most (and yes, I own the first two, also, which I know that many people prefer). On this CD, the band expands their sound without radically changing it. I like it when a punk band does that, as opposed to simply trying recreate their early successes over and over (and usually failing).
